168 Grams of acrylamide, 42 grams of acrylic acid, 63 grams of Na2CO3, 0.21 gram of pentasodium (carboxymethylimino)bis(ethylene-nitrilo)tetraacetic acid (Versenex 80), 0.042 gram of methylene-bisacrylamide, 0.105 gram of sodium metabisulfite and 0.105 gram of tertiary butyl hydroperoxide are dissolved in 1050 grams of deionized water and sufficient sodium hydroxide added thereto to bring the mixture to a pH of 9.5. The resulting solution is mixed with an oil phase consisting of 31.5 grams of acrylic acid and 6.3 grams of a suspending agent consisting of a chloromethylated polystyrene-dimethylamine reaction product, wherein about 5-10 percent of the aromatic rings are aminated, dissolved in 1575 milliliters of xylene. The resulting mixture is sheared at high speed in a Waring Blendor for two minutes, placed in an agitated reactor and purged with nitrogen. The temperature of the reaction vessel and contents is raised to 63° C. over a period of one hour and thereafter held at about 52° C. for an additional 2.5 hours to complete the polymerization reaction. A portion of the resulting slurry is then dewatered by azeotropic distillation and the resulting suspension filtered to separate the copolymer in the form of microgels. The latter are washed with acetone and dried. The ability of the microgels to swell in aqueous fluid is measured and it is found that the copolymer held 82 grams of aqueous 0.27 molar sodium chloride solution per gram of copolymer. To a further 55 gram portion of the above copolymer slurry are added 27.7 milliliters of dimethylamine and then 14.8 grams of paraformaldehyde slurried in a little xylene. The resulting mixture is heated to 40° C. for 1.5 hours, filtered, and dried by acetone extraction to give cationic, cross-linked polyacrylamide microgels, ranging in size between 0.2 and 4 microns in diameter. The product absorbs 50 grams of aqueous 0.27 M NaCl solution per gram of product. The grams of aqueous fluid absorbed and held by one gram of dry polymer beads (dried gels) is herein referred to as the "gel capacity" of the polymer. The product upon being uniformly dispersed in water, quickly thickens the water to give a viscous, "short", pseudoplastic dispersion.
